Admission Reality Check

Seats are filled on a mixed basis (TNEA + management). While the minimum eligibility is 50%, actual cut-offs usually run much higher because of SSN’s reputation. Plan your counselling strategy accordingly.

The verdict

Good fit

SSN’s EEE program offers a rare combo: strong core electrical recruiting (Schneider, ABB, Siemens) alongside IT fallback options. The ₹2.5L/year fee is steep but justified by solid placements and NAAC ‘A’ infrastructure. Best if you want a balanced electrical + software career and can handle the suburban Chennai commute.
